Belarusian Amkodor to strengthen cooperation with Russia's Tuva

The Amkodor holding company is set to strengthen cooperation with the Republic of Tuva, Russia, BelTA learned from the press service of the Belarusian company.

Amkodor's representatives took part in a meeting of the joint working group on cooperation between Belarus and the Republic of Tuva of the Russian Federation.

The parties considered the prospects of the Belarusian holding company in the production and promotion of special equipment in the Republic of Tuva. The parties also discussed issues of further cooperation with the region, with the main focus on the possibilities to increase the sales of construction and agricultural machinery to this region.

At the end of the meeting the parties signed the minutes of the meeting of the joint working group on cooperation between Belarus and the Republic of Tuva.

Amkodor was established in 1927. The company consists of 30 legal entities, 22 factories that produce more than 6,500 products, including 135 models and modifications of special-purpose and agricultural vehicles and machines. All Amkodor enterprises are integrated into a single technological chain. Each member specializes in specific machines, units and assemblies. Amkodor constantly develops new models of machines and vehicles and improves existing ones.
